Hi Elaine
Hanging in there. slowly getting better overall, but its 2 steps forward 1 or 2 back any given day. Still have the anxiety hit now and again and my mind is not as clear as used to be, but coming around little by little. Some days I just go thru the motions, as you would say like its not really me. Granted I am still on the patch for about another week. i'm on step 3. each step was a challenge and almost felt like week 1 again. Like all things this to shall pass, the clouds will part and the sun will shine. Keep the faith. I pray your relief is on its way.
